Top Conservative Podcasts

The Ben Shapiro Show

Hosted by Ben Shapiro, this podcast offers a sharp, intellectual take on current events, politics, and culture. Shapiro's fast-paced delivery and articulate arguments have made this one of the most popular conservative podcasts.

The Dan Bongino Show

Dan Bongino, a former Secret Service agent, brings a passionate and energetic approach to his analysis of political issues. His podcast is known for its strong opinions and unwavering defense of conservative principles.

The Michael Knowles Show

Key Issues Discussed

Conservative podcasts frequently cover a range of important issues, including:

  • Economic Policy: Discussions on tax cuts, deregulation, and free-market principles.
  • Social Issues: Debates on abortion, religious freedom, and family values.
  • National Security: Analysis of foreign policy, military spending, and counterterrorism efforts.
  • Government Regulation: Critiques of government overreach and calls for limited government.
